Konami Gaming Inc. has achieved ISO/IEC 27001 certification for its information security management system (ISMS), underscoring its dedication to high cybersecurity and data protection standards. This certification applies to both its Synkros casino management system and the Konami Online Interactive iGaming platform.
Carried out by Schellman & Co. LLC, the certification encompasses the company’s security governance, operational controls, and risk management processes, which are essential for its land-based and online gaming technologies.
ISO/IEC 27001 serves as the worldwide standard for information security management. It mandates that organizations implement a thorough framework for recognizing, managing, and continually enhancing information security risks. Konami Gaming’s certification is valid for three years, with annual surveillance audits scheduled to begin in 2027 to ensure ongoing compliance and evaluate the effectiveness of its security measures.
The assessment involved a detailed independent audit of various business functions, including information technology, cybersecurity, technical compliance, human resources, systems engineering, marketing, and iGaming operations.
The certification specifically includes Synkros, the casino management system utilized by gaming operators around the globe. The scope of the certification also encompasses Konami Online Interactive, addressing the platform’s development, deployment, and daily operations. Eduardo Aching, Vice President of iGaming and International Gaming Operations, referred to this accomplishment as a significant step forward in Konami’s ongoing investment in cybersecurity and responsible digital gaming infrastructure. By unifying both its online and land-based technologies under a common information security framework, Konami has developed a consistent governance model throughout its product offerings.

Instead of launching new products or features, the certification serves as independent validation that the company’s security management practices meet international standards. As cybersecurity becomes increasingly critical across the global gaming landscape, the ISO 27001 certification provides operators with added confidence that Konami’s systems are founded on solid information security protocols and are subjected to continuous independent scrutiny.
